
South Korea Tunnel Sensor Market Overview
The South Korea tunnel sensor market is experiencing significant growth, driven by the country’s robust infrastructure development and technological advancements. As of 2023, the market size is estimated at approximately USD 250 million, with projections indicating a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 8.5% over the forecast period from 2023 to 2030. This growth is fueled by increasing investments in urban transportation projects, smart city initiatives, and modernization of existing tunnel infrastructure. The rising demand for advanced safety and monitoring systems in tunnels, coupled with the integration of IoT-enabled sensors, is further propelling market expansion. South Korea’s focus on sustainable and resilient infrastructure also supports the adoption of innovative sensor technologies that enhance operational efficiency and safety standards across transportation networks.

Key Trends in the South Korea Tunnel Sensor Market
- AI Integration in Sensor Systems: The incorporation of artificial intelligence into tunnel sensors is transforming data analysis and predictive maintenance. AI algorithms enable real-time anomaly detection, fault prediction, and operational optimization, reducing downtime and enhancing safety. South Korea’s focus on smart infrastructure accelerates AI adoption, making sensor networks more intelligent and autonomous.
- Automation Technologies: Automation in tunnel monitoring, including robotic inspection and automated data collection, is gaining traction. These technologies improve efficiency, reduce human error, and facilitate continuous surveillance of tunnel conditions, especially in complex or hazardous environments.
- Cloud-Based Data Platforms: Cloud platforms are increasingly used for storing, analyzing, and sharing tunnel sensor data. This trend supports remote management, scalable data processing, and integration with other smart city systems, fostering a connected and agile infrastructure ecosystem.
- Smart Manufacturing and Production Technologies: The adoption of Industry 4.0 practices in sensor manufacturing enhances product quality, customization, and supply chain efficiency. South Korea’s advanced manufacturing sector is pivotal in developing high-precision sensors tailored for tunnel safety applications.
